The Role:
As the Quality Support Officer, you will maintain internal quality systems to ensure proactive organisational compliance with relevant legislative and contractual obligations. Your role will include performing internal audits and proactive monitoring to ensure the company consistently delivers the highest degree of quality and compliance across our contracted services.

This position is ideal for someone who is passionate about people and processes, and will see you assisting with the development, implementation and ongoing maintenance of our Quality Framework and Quality Management System.

In this diverse, yet fast-paced role you will exercise a high level of confidentiality, integrity, communication and organisation to ensure all business critical matters are addressed in a timely manner.

The role conducts site and desktop audits and develops operational standards in line with operating requirements, contracts and Deeds. The Quality Support Officer also delivers compliance training to staff and supports the continuous improvement process.

Key accountabilities include: Contributes to the design, development and implementation of Quality processes and proceduresLeads the Quality experience across the Workforce Australia teamDrives quality improvement initiatives and processes to support high quality Workforce Australia ServicesConducts audits in line with the program audit scheduleUndertakes regular desktop and site monitoring activities (internal policies/procedures, contractual compliance)Assists management and leaders to identify non-compliance and works to ensure corrective actions are undertaken should non-compliances existDelivers quality and compliance training to new and existing staffLiaises with internal and external stakeholders including Department of Education, Skills and Employment Contract Managers for the purposes of audits and monitoring and changes to Department requirements. To be successful in this role you will meet the following Key Selection Criteria: Relevant tertiary qualifications or equivalent experience within the Employment Services, Training, or a similar type sector is highly desirableA working knowledge of contracted  employment services and applicable quality standards including Right Fit for Risk (RFFR) and the Quality Assurance FrameworkRelevant experience in quality assurance within an employment services or related fieldExperienced in the development of policies and proceduresExperience supporting the design and delivery of training that delivers on operational business needsExperience in stakeholder engagement and managementExperience in the coordination of monitoring and reporting activitiesExperience undertaking monitoring and audit activitiesExcellent verbal and written communication skills and able to adapt style to suit audience.High level of resilience and ability to remain calm and keep a positive attitude when responding to a range of situations.Highly organised, able to multitask whilst keeping to quality standards with accurate attention to detail.Applies initiative with a strong problem solving orientation, continuously seeks ways to find further opportunities to add value.Ability to work effectively and collaboratively in a team.Ability to effectively conduct Quality and Compliance monitoring, audits and review Benefits:
